You cannot select more than 25 topics Topics must start with a letter or number, can include dashes ('-') and can be up to 35 characters long.

151 lines
6.3 KiB
HTML

<!DOCTYPE HTML>
<html>
<head>
<meta charset="UTF-8">
<title></title>
<meta name="keywords" content="" />
<meta name="description" content="" />
<meta http-equiv="Content-Type" content="text/html; charset=UTF-8">
<meta charset="utf-8">
<meta name="renderer" content="webkit">
<meta http-equiv="X-UA-Compatible" content="IE=edge,chrome=1">
<meta name="viewport" content="width=device-width, initial-scale=1.0, maximum-scale=1.0, user-scalable=0">
<meta name="applicable-device" content="mobile">
<link href="__CSS__/iconfont.css" rel="stylesheet" >
<link href="__CSS__/common.css" rel="stylesheet" >
<link href="__CSS__/unlr.css" rel="stylesheet" >
<script src="__JS__/jquery-1.11.1.min.js"></script>
</head>
<body class="unlr">
<header class="header forget-header">
<div class="">
<if condition="I('get.pid') gt 0">
<a href="{:U('login',array('pid'=>I('get.pid'),'gid'=>I('get.gid')))}" class="hbtn back"><i class="iconfont icon-drop-left"></i></a>
<else/>
<a href="{:U('login')}" class="hbtn back"><i class="iconfont icon-drop-left"></i></a>
</if>
<h1 class="caption">账号注册</h1>
</div>
</header>
<div class="occupy"></div>
<section class="trunker">
<section class="container">
<div class="t-form register-form">
<form class="register-box" id="login_form">
<div class="form-group clearfix">
<div class="input-group clearfix">
<span class="mark-text"><span class="table"><span class="table-cell">账号</span></span></span>
<span class="inputbox">
<input type="text" name="" class="txt" id="account" autocomplete="off" placeholder="" maxlength="15">
</span>
</div>
<div class="input-group clearfix">
<span class="mark-text"><span class="table"><span class="table-cell">密码</span></span></span>
<span class="inputbox">
<input type="text" name="" class="txt" id="password" autocomplete="off" placeholder="6-15字符" onfocus="this.type='password'" minlength="6">
</span>
</div>
<div class="input-group clearfix">
<span class="mark-text"><span class="table"><span class="table-cell">昵称</span></span></span>
<span class="inputbox">
<input type="text" name="" class="txt" id="nickname" autocomplete="off" placeholder="" maxlength="15">
</span>
</div>
<div class="input-group clearfix">
<span class="mark-text"><span class="table"><span class="table-cell">性别</span></span></span>
<span class="inputbox">
<label class="input-radio">
<input type="radio" name="sex" class="radio sex <if condition='$sex == 0'>on</if>" value="0" checked><i class="iconfont icon-male"></i><span></span>
</label>
<label class="input-radio">
<input type="radio" name="sex" class="radio sex <if condition='$sex == 1'>on</if>" value="1"><i class="iconfont icon-female"></i><span></span>
</label>
</span>
</div>
</div>
<div class="btn-group">
<input type="button" class="submit nextsubmit" value="注册">
</div>
<p class="agree">注册账号表示您同意<a href="{:U('News/protocol')}">《最终用户协议》</a></p>
</form>
</div>
</section>
</section>
<div class="popmsg pop-dialog"></div>
<script src="__JS__/pop.lwx.min.js"></script>
<script src="__JS__/common.js"></script>
<script>
var pmsg = $('.popmsg').pop();
$(function() {
$('input[name=sex]').change(function() {
var that = $(this);
$('input[name=sex]').removeClass('on');
if (that.prop('checked')) {
that.addClass('on');
}
});
});
$('.nextsubmit').click(function(event) {
var account = $.trim($('#account').val());
var nickname = $.trim($('#nickname').val())
var password = $.trim($('#password').val());
var sex = $.trim($('input[name=sex]:checked').val());
var promoteId = parseInt("{:I('get.pid')}") ? parseInt("{:I('get.pid')}") : 0;
var gameId = parseInt("{:I('get.gid')}") ? parseInt("{:I('get.gid')}") : 0;
if(account.length == 0 ){
pmsg.msg('账号不能为空');event.preventDefault();
return false;
}
if(nickname.length == 0 ){
pmsg.msg('昵称不能为空');event.preventDefault();
return false;
}
if(password.length == 0){
pmsg.msg('密码不能为空');event.preventDefault();
return false;
}
if(account.length > 15 ){
pmsg.msg('账号在15个字符以内');event.preventDefault();
return false;
}
if(nickname.length > 15 ){
pmsg.msg('昵称在15个字符以内');event.preventDefault();
return false;
}
if(password.length < 6 || password.length > 15){
pmsg.msg('密码长度6-15个字符');event.preventDefault();
return false;
}
if (account) {
if (password) {
$.ajax({
type:'POST',
url:'{:U("User/step1")}',
data:{'account':account,'nickname':nickname,'password':password,'sex':sex,'promote_id':promoteId,'game_id':gameId},
dataType:"Json",
success:function(data){
pmsg.msg(data.msg);
if(parseInt(data.status) == 1){
window.location.href = data.url;
}
},
error:function(data){
console.log(data);
}
});
} else{
pmsg.msg('请输入密码');event.preventDefault();
}
} else {
pmsg.msg('请输入账号');event.preventDefault();
}
});
</script>
</body>
</html>